    Dolby Atmos is protocol that defines speaker placement and sound channels.

    It has nothing to do with an individual speaker.

    “Dolby Atmos” soundbars work by bouncing sound, primarily off the ceiling. It’s a poor representation compared to using individual speakers with proper placement, and Dolby Atmos soundbars are highly dependent on having optimal room acoustic in order to sound good.

    You need both equipment and source material that takes advantage of Dolby Atmos.

    Dolby Atmos is usually found on 4K uhd blu-ray and streaming, assuming the movie supports Dolby Atmos. But there are enough movies on standard Bluray, that you can’t make a blanket statement that Dolby Atmos isn’t seen on blu-ray. But its a small fraction of movies compared to 4k bluray and streaming.

    In the context of speakers: the speaker is just a speaker and only knows what’s sent to it from the AV receiver.

    I’m sure there are others, Pioneer used to sell a speaker with a ATMOS speaker in the top that fired towards the ceiling. Typically you would have the ATMOS speakers mounted in the ceiling to the sides and in front of the screen.
